Ukraine's highest anti-corruption court has ordered the pre-trial detention of Agriculture Minister Mykola Solskyi on suspicion of misappropriation of state land worth millions. The preventive measure is initially set to run until June 24, media in Kiev reported on Friday, citing the court. There is a possibility that Solskyi will be released on bail, the reports said. Ukraine’s High Anti-Corruption Court has chosen to detain Agriculture Minister Mykola Solskyi until June 24, setting his bail at 75 million UAH ($1.9 million), Suspilne reported on April 26.
